SL bank assets up to Rs. 20 trillion

SL bank assets up to Rs. 20 trillion

19 Feb 2024 | BY Imesh Ranasinghe


Sri Lanka's banking sector assets grew by 5.1% to Rs 20.4 trillion in 2023 mainly due to increased investments in government securities while the Non-Performing Loans (NPL) ratio was at 12.8% by the end of the year, Central Bank data showed.

According to the Monetary Policy report by the Central Bank of Sri Lanka (CBSL), despite the banking sector operating in a challenging environment during the financial year ended in December 2023, the total assets grew by 5.1% year on year to Rs. 20.4 trillion by the end of the year, mainly due to increased investments in government securities.

By the end of November 2023, the total investments in government securities by the banking sector stood at Rs 5.3 trillion, an increase of over 200% compared to the corresponding period in 2022.

However, the loans and receivables of the banking sector contracted by 2.8% during the year ending December 2023, amidst the tight monetary policy stance that was in place until June 2023. 

However, a gradual increase in credit was witnessed during the second half of 2023 with the easing of policy interest rates by the Central Bank while the NPL ratio remained at an elevated level of 12.8% at the end of December 2023 compared to the corresponding period of the previous year. 

The growth in Stage 3 loans has been decelerating since June 2023 with the expansion in loans and receivables, indicating a stabilisation of credit risk in the banking sector. 

“The sovereign-bank nexus remained elevated as the banking sector’s exposure to the Central Government and State-Owned Enterprises increased to Rs 9.0 trillion at the end of December 2023, particularly through investments in Rupee-denominated government securities.” CBSL said.

As a result, the report said that the liquid asset ratios of the banking sector significantly increased which was reflected by the expansion in the Statutory Liquid Assets Ratio of Domestic Banking Units to 44.9% at the end of December 2023 compared to 29.9% at the end of the corresponding period of the previous year.

Further, the report said that the Licensed Finance Companies (LFCs) sector recorded a contraction in its loans and advances portfolio in 2023, due to challenges in its core business of leasing and hire purchase. The asset quality of the sector deteriorated as indicated by the elevated Gross

The LFCs recorded a stage 3 loans ratio of 17.8% at the end of December 2023 compared to 17.4% in 2022 while the NPL to total loans ratio has recorded a deceleration from its highest level of 20.55 observed in May 2023, indicating an improvement in default risk during the second half of 2023. 

The liquidity position of the sector remained above the regulatory requirement, mainly due to increased investments in government securities. Capital adequacy of the sector improved with higher growth in regulatory capital compared to risk-weighted assets. 

However, there is a need for continued consolidation within the sector to ensure resilience, the report further noted.
